Tabulky

Jirka Kosek jirka na kosek.cz
Pátek Říjen 17 14:48:36 CEST 2008


Tomáš Waller wrote:

> 1. Použil jsem teď saxon místo xsltproc, ovšem v něm jsou šířky sloupců, 
> jak se mu zlíbí, nejsou nastaveny dle zdrojového xml v poměrech 1*, 2* 
> apod. Co s tím?

Asi bych musel vidět nějaký příklad, abych pochopil, co se vám nelíbí.
Můžete vypnout funkci, která se snaží o přepočet šířek sloupců pomocí:

<xsl:param name="tablecolumns.extension" select="0"/>

> 2. A dále to, že pro pdf potřebuji zalomit tabulky na rozdíl od html. 
> Mám pocit, že tabulky, které jsem měl rozděleny hardpagebreakem na 
> dvojici table a informaltable pro pdf, při převodu pomocí xsltproc do 
> html tytéž dvojice tento xsltproc spojil dohromady do jedné tabulky, ale 
> teď mi to nedělá, bohužel v tom mám nyní zmatek, kde jsem co nevhodně 
> přepnul. Saxon alespoň delší tabulku rozdělí sám, ale uprostřed buňky. 
> Musí být ovšem opravvdu o hodně delší. 

Dlouhé tabulky zasádně nedělte ručně, při generování PDF se rozdělí
automaticky. Stačí mít v tabulce řádky zahlaví obalené pomocí elementu
thead.

> A i když se náhodou strefí na 
> hranici buněk, buňka na nové stráncew v pdf nemá horní okrajovou čáru.

<xsl:attribute-set name="table.table.properties">
  <xsl:attribute
name="border-after-width.conditionality">retain</xsl:attribute>
  <xsl:attribute
name="border-before-width.conditionality">retain</xsl:attribute>
</xsl:attribute-set>

-- 
------------------------------------------------------------------
  Jirka Kosek     e-mail: jirka na kosek.cz     http://www.kosek.cz
------------------------------------------------------------------
  Profesionální školení a poradenství v oblasti technologií XML.
       Podrobný přehled školení http://xmlguru.cz/skoleni/
------------------------------------------------------------------
                   Nejbližší termíny školení:
       ** XSLT 16.-19.9.2008 ** XML schémata 21.-23.10. **
    ** XSL-FO 18.-19.11.2008 ** XML pro vývojáře 16.-18.12. **
------------------------------------------------------------------
  http://docbook.cz    Stránky o dokumentačním formátu DocBook
  http://xmlguru.cz    Blog mostly about XML for English readers
------------------------------------------------------------------

------------- další část ---------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 250 bytes
Desc: OpenPGP digital signature
URL: <http://www.linux.cz/pipermail/docbook/attachments/20081017/127b5fa3/attachment.sig>


Další informace o konferenci Docbook